Latest Patents

Mita's latest patents include groundbreaking inventions such as power semiconductor devices incorporating a single crystalline aluminum nitride substrate. This invention provides a power semiconductor device that features an aluminum nitride single crystalline substrate with a dislocation density of less than about 10 cm, and a Full Width Half Maximum (FWHM) of the double axis rocking curve for the (002) and (102) crystallographic planes of less than about 200 arcsec. Additionally, he has developed optoelectronic devices that emit ultraviolet light, which also utilize an aluminum nitride single crystalline substrate with similar specifications. These devices include an ultraviolet light-emitting diode structure that is designed for enhanced performance and longevity.
